The cost of living difference between Pewee Valley, KY and Williamstown, KY is dramatic. Williamstown is 67.7% cheaper than Pewee Valley,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Pewee Valley has a cost index of 116 while Williamstown sits at 69,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Pewee Valley are $532,900 compared to $159,100 in Williamstown, a 235% gap.

Median household income in Pewee Valley is $139,688 compared to $71,761 in Williamstown (+94.7%). While Pewee Valley is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
